ok guys, am wondering if the ba sedan fuel filter is in the same spot as an au sedan, tucked up in front of the boot under the car? from memory it was a pain in the bum to change, but i think my ba needs doing... is there only one type of filter i can buy, or is there different ones for abs, irs , xr8, xr6 and all that stuff?

On the passenger side roughly underneath the back seat, just follow the fuel lines from the tank you'll find it. It's easy to change, only hard bit is if its done up fairly tight. Only one filter for BAs as well. Just unplug the fuel pump or remove the fuel pump fuse then run the car till it stalls to remove most of the petrol from the lines.
